House of Commons Votes and Proceedings
Friday 4th February 2000

The House met at half-past Nine o'clock.

PRAYERS.
1 Northern Ireland Bill,—Mr Secretary Mandelson, supported by the Prime Minister, Mr Secretary Straw, Mr Secretary Reid and Mr Secretary Murphy, presented a Bill to make provision for the suspension of devolved government in Northern Ireland and the exercise of certain functions conferred by or under Part V of the Northern Ireland Act 1998; and for connected purposes; And the same was read the first time; and ordered to be read a second time on Monday 7th February and to be printed [Bill 61].

    Ordered, That the Explanatory Notes relating to the Northern Ireland Billl be printed [Bill 61—EN].

2 Carers and Disabled Children Bill,—The Carers and Disabled Children Bill was, according to Order, read a second time and stood committed to a Standing Committee.
3 Export of Farm Animals Bill,—The Order of the day being read, for the Second Reading of the Export of Farm Animals Bill;
      Ordered, That the Bill be read a second time on Friday 7th April.
4 Welfare of Broiler Chickens Bill,—The Order of the day being read, for the Second Reading of the Welfare of Broiler Chickens Bill;
      Ordered, That the Bill be read a second time on Friday 7th April.
5 Fire Prevention Bill,—The Order of the day being read, for the Second Reading of the Fire Prevention Bill;
      Ordered, That the Bill be read a second time on Friday 7th April.
6 Northern Ireland Bill,—Ordered, That, in respect of the Northern Ireland Bill, notices of Amendments, new Clauses and new Schedules to be moved in Committee may be accepted by the Clerks at the Table before the Bill has been read a second time.—(Mr Greg Pope.)
7 Adjournment,—Resolved, That this House do now adjourn..—(Mr Greg Pope.)
 
        And accordingly the House, having continued to sit till six minutes to Three o'clock, adjourned till Monday 7th February.
[Adjourned at 2.54 p.m.
Betty Boothroyd
Speaker        

Madam Speaker will take the Chair at half-past Two o'clock on Monday next.


APPENDIX

Papers presented or laid upon the Table:

Papers subject to Negative Resolution:
1 Agriculture,—Agriculture (Closure of Grant Schemes) (England) Regulations 2000 (S.I. 2000, No. 205), dted 31st January 2000 [by Act] [Mr Mr Nicholas Brown].
2 Local Government,—(1) Local Authorities (Alteration of Requisite Calculations) (England) Regulations 2000 (S.I., 2000, No. 213), and

    (2) Major Precepting Authorities (Excessive Budget Requirements-Payments) (England) Regulations 200 (S.I., 2000, No. 214)

dated 3rd February 2000 [by Act] [Mr Secretary Prescott].

Other Papers:
3 Miscellaneous (No. 1, 2000),—Food Aid Convention, 1999, adopted at London on 13th April 1999, with an Explanatory Memorandum [by Command] [Cm. 4591] [Mr Secretary Cook].
4 Norway (No. 1, 2000),—Framework Agreement, done at Oslo on 25th August 1998, between the Government of the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land and the Government of the Kingdom of Norway relating to the Laying, Operation and Jurisdiction of Inter-Connecting Submarine Pipelines, with an Explanatory Memorandum [by Command] [Cm. 4580] [Mr Secretary Cook].
5 Norway (No. 2, 2000),—Agreement, done at Oslo on 25th August 1998, between the Government of the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land and the Government of the Kingdom of Norway relating to the Amendment of the Agreement of 10th May 1976 relating to the Exploitation of the Frigg Field Reservoir and the Transmission of Gas therefrom to the United Kingdom, with an Explanatory Memorandum [by Command] [Cm. 4581] [Mr Secretary Cook].
6 Sea Fisheries,—Report by the Minister of Agriculture, Fisheries and Food on the proceedings under sections 1 to 5 of the Sea Fisheries (Shellfish) Act 1967, for 1999 [by Act] [Mr Nicholas Brown].
